Healthcare bills now comprise the greatest percentage of consumer debt, and medical debt is the number one reason why Americans file for bankruptcy. We all know that something's wrong with healthcare in this country. In An American Sickness, Elisabeth Rosenthal attempts to break down some of the perverse incentives that lead to rising healthcare costs, costs that quickly add up.
